试题查看

首页 > 计算机二级考试 > 试题查看
【分析解答题】

请编写一个函数voiD Fun(int p[],int n,int C),其中数组p的元素按由小到大的顺序排列,其元素个数为n。函数Fun()的功能是将C插入到数组p中,且保持数组的升序排列。
注意:部分源程序已存在文件proC9.Cpp中。
请勿修改主函数和其他函数中的任何内容,仅在函数Fun()的花括号中填写若干语句;
文件proC9.Cpp的内容如下:
//proC9.Cpp
#inCluDE <iostrEAm>
#inCluDE <string>
using nAmEspACE stD;
#DEFinE m 30
voiD Fun(int p[ ],int n,int C);
int mAin ()
int pp[m],n,i;
int Fg, C;
Cout<<"plEAsE input n:\n";
Cin>>n;
Cout<<"plEAsE input thE n DAtA:\n";
For (i=0; i<n; i++)
Cin>>pp [i];
Cout<<"plEAsE input C:\n";
Cin>>C;
Fun (pp, n, C);
For (i=0; i<n; i++)
Cout<<pp [i] << " " ;
Cout<<EnD1;
rEturn 0;
voiD Fun(int p[ ],int n, int C)
//* * * * * * * * *

查看答案解析

参考答案:

正在加载...

答案解析

正在加载...

根据网考网移动考试中心的统计,该试题:

0%的考友选择了A选项

0%的考友选择了B选项

0%的考友选择了C选项

0%的考友选择了D选项

你可能感兴趣的试题

下列说法正确的是()。A.在C语言中,可以使用动态内存分配技术,定义元素个数可变下列程序的输出结果是()。main()intp[8]=11,12,13,14,1有以下程序:main()inti,j,x=0;for(i=0;i<2;i++)x若执行下面的程序时,从键盘输入6和2,则输出结果是main()inta,b,k;有以下程序:fun(intx)intp;if(x==0||x==1)return有以下程序,其中%u表示按无符号整数输出main()unsignedintx=0